Transaction 29a118356ce5326dbfb2b2955d3acd27fdec3b458f218767c4e89f83ae59e455
1 Input
1 Output
-
29a118356ce5326dbfb2b2955d3acd27fdec3b458f218767c4e89f83ae59e455:0
- value
- 26987380
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c135a10030f1ec8fffa88cdac40f636f1249b9d6 OP_EQUAL
- address
- 3KJcamZ2gNP1XpA5QjsnzZHo1HRv2su1CT